Jaron Name Meaning, Origin, History, And Popularity Jaron primarily comes from Hebrew origins and means to ‘sing out’ or ‘cry of rejoice ’ It is widely accepted as the English equivalent of the Hebrew name Yaron (יָרוֹן), a combination of the Hebrew term ron, meaning ‘to sing’ or ‘shout praises,’ and the prefix Ya
